Online Class Availability at Mercer University
Distance learning is available at Mercer University. Of 9,196 students, 2,029 (22%) studied exclusively online and 1,218 (13%) took at least some classes online.

Student Demographics & Diversity
Take a look at the student demographics for Family Practice Nursing graduates at Mercer University, by degree type.
Program-wide, Family Practice Nursing graduates at Mercer University are 100% women (18) and 0% men (0).
Family Practice Nursing Master’s Program at Mercer University
Of the 15 master’s family practice nursing graduates at Mercer University, 100% were women (15) and 0% were men (0).
The following table and chart show the race/ethnicity of Family Practice Nursing master’s degree recipients at Mercer University.
| Race / Ethnicity | Number of Graduates |
|---|---|
| White | 10 |
| Black / African American | 2 |
| Asian | 3 |
Minority students account for 33% of Family Practice Nursing master’s degree recipients at Mercer University, lower than the national average of 41%.*
Family Practice Nursing Doctoral Program at Mercer University
Among the 3 doctoral family practice nursing degrees awarded at Mercer University, 100% were women (3) and 0% were men (0).
The following table and chart show the race/ethnicity of Family Practice Nursing doctoral degree recipients at Mercer University.
| Race / Ethnicity | Number of Graduates |
|---|---|
| White | 1 |
| Black / African American | 1 |
| Unknown | 1 |
Racial-ethnic minorities make up 33% of Family Practice Nursing doctoral degree recipients at Mercer University, below the national average of 53%.*
*The racial-ethnic minorities figure is the total number of graduates minus White, international (nonresident), and unknown-race graduates.
